S. 3266, the USMMA Athletics Act of 2025, passed the Senate on August 6, 2026.

S. 3266 — USMMA Athletics Act of 2025

Military Personnel

What it does

This bill authorizes the Department of Transportation to create a nonprofit corporation, governed under New York law and owned entirely by the U.S. government, to manage and support athletic programs at the United States Merchant Marine Academy. The corporation can enter sole-source contracts, lease Academy property, accept donations and sponsorship fees from the NCAA and other sources, license the Academy's trademarks, and retain all revenue for athletics—with DOT employees providing oversight but not day-to-day control.

What happens next

S. 3266 passed the Senate. It now moves to the other chamber.

Who is behind it

Filed by Roger Wicker. Cosponsored by Mark Kelly.
